I knew nothing about these cars, and I did my blend door in 9 hours. It was follow the instructions on the web site, use my laptop when I got stumped, and take my time. Aside from replacing alternators and water pumps on old GM 350's, this was the first major car repair that I performed.

It was very cool when I started the car and the heat came on, I can tell you. But 45 minutes of that 9 hours was trying to get that goddam blend door hooked onto whatever it comes off of, cause you sure as :q:q:q:q can't see the :q:q:q:qer back there when you're trying to hook the actuator back on while positioning the motor.

Take my advice and take off the driver's information center. It's another step, but it allows you to get both hands on that little bastard.

The key here is patience....

The step by step instructions (aided by some really good pics) are everything you'll need to complete the job, if you have the time and tools.

It's somewhere north of a Grand to have a mechanic do it, and he's replacing a ~40dollar part.
